• 제목/요약/키워드: Workflow Application

검색결과 137건 처리시간 0.062초

An XML and Component-based IDE for Document Flow Application

  • Xiaoqin, Xie;Juanzi, Li;Lu, Ma;Kehong, Wang
    • 한국디지털정책학회:학술대회논문집
    • /
    • 한국디지털정책학회 2004년도 International Conference on Digital Policy & Management
    • /
    • pp.299-310
    • /
    • 2004
  • Business process in e-government mostly embody as the flow of documents. Constructing a web-based document flow system becomes an critical task for today s digital government. But few of them use an off-the-shelf workflow product. Why? One of the reasons is that most of the workflow system are heavyweight, monolithic, and package a comprehensive set of features in an all-or-nothing manner. Another reason is that workflow technology lacks the constructs and modeling capability as programming language. It is incumbent on government IT organizations to transform their solution development to component-based computing model. Component technology isolates the computation and communication parts, but how to compose different software components is still a hard nut. An integrated development environment is necessary for CBSD. In this paper we propose a XML and component-based document flow-oriented integrated development environment (DFoIDE) for software developers. By writing some xml configure file, and operate on DFoIDE, developer can construct a workflow application quickly. This method divides system to several components and the activities in process are implemented as business component. Different components are discribed detailedly in this paper, especially one of the core component. Component Integrating Tool. Different perspectives in workflow application are seperated and depicted as different XML files. Correspondly, A component composition method for developing workflow application instead of workflow itself is proposed.

  • PDF

그리드 환경에서 협업을 위한 워크플로우 프로세스 단위 기반의 애플리케이션 컨텐츠 배포 시스템 (Application Contents Deploy System based on workflow process a unit based for collaboration in Grid Environment)

  • 문석재;허혁;최영근
    • 한국정보통신학회논문지
    • /
    • 제12권1호
    • /
    • pp.172-182
    • /
    • 2008
  • 그리드 환경에서 워크플로우 프로세스 단위 기반의 애플리케이션 컨텐츠는 특정한 문제 해결을 위한 실질적인 작업이며, 그리드 자원에 분산 배포되고 서로 연관되어 실행되기 때문에 협업 환경을 구성하는 것은 매우 중요한 부분이다. 그리고 대부분의 협업은 워크플로우를 통하여 구체화되고, 그리드 환경에서 협업처리를 위한 미들웨어로는 Globus toolkit이 대표적이다. 하지만 이 미들웨어는 그리드 환경 구축을 위한 기본 서비스들만을 제공하고, 협업을 할 수 있는 워크플로우 생성, 작업 스케줄링, 프로세스 단위 기반의 애플리케이션 관리 같은 부분은 적용되지 않는다. 또한 Globus Toolkit은 대형화된 그리드 커뮤니티 구성에는 적합하나, 소규모 대다수가 특정한 운영 체제로 구성된 대형화된 그리드 커뮤니티 구성에는 적합하지 않고, 소규모 대다수가 특정한 운영체제로 구성된 그리드 커뮤니티 구성에는 부적합하다. 따라서 본 논문에서는 그리드 환경에서 소규모 협업 처리에 효율적인 워크플로우 프로세스 단위 기반의 애플리케이션 배포 시스템을 제안한다. 이 시스템은 애플리케이션 배포, 그리드 커뮤니티에 구성된 자원관리 등의 역할을 통해 효율적인 협업 환경을 지원한다. 또한 워크플로우 프로세스 단위 기반의 애플리케이션간 연관 관계 사전을 만들어 협업에 필요한 애플리케이션간의 정보 및 연관 관계를 표현하여 애플리케이션을 배포하는 기반 정보로도 활용한다.

워크플로우 마이닝을 위한 워크플로우 최적 축소 모델 (Minimal Workflow Model for Workflow Mining)

  • 박민재;원재강;김창민;김광훈
    • 인터넷정보학회논문지
    • /
    • 제6권6호
    • /
    • pp.57-69
    • /
    • 2005
  • 본 논문에서는 워크플로우 프로세스 재발견 문제를 해결하기 위한 적절한 해결책으로 워크플로우 최적 축소 모델을 제안한다. 워크플로우 최적 축소 모델은 워크플로우 최적 축소 넷으로 표현할 수 있다. ICN(Information Control Net) 모델링 기법으로 표현되는 프로세스 모델은 ICN을 구성하고 있는 액티비티 사이의 액티비티 의존성에 따라 적절한 알고리즘의 적용으로 액티비티 의존 넷을 구성할 수 있다. 워크플로우 최적 넷 또한 액티비티 의존 넷의 몇 가지 속성에 대한 알고리즘 적용으로 찾아낼 수 있으며, 찾아낸 워크플로우 최적 넷을 프로세스 재발견 문제를 해결하기 위한 방안으로 제안하며, 프로세스 개선에도 의미를 둘 수 있다.

  • PDF

웹 서비스를 이용한 워크플로우 관리 시스템의 설계 방안 (Design of Workflow Management System using Web Services)

  • 오명은;이용표;한상용
    • 한국전자거래학회:학술대회논문집
    • /
    • 한국전자거래학회 2003년도 종합학술대회 논문집
    • /
    • pp.230-235
    • /
    • 2003
  • A Workflow Management System is one which provides procedural automation of a business process by management of the sequence of work activities. The existing workflow management systems have limitation of interaction among application systems. In this paper, we propose a new workflow management system that can be adapted in dynamically changed paradigm of distributed computing by using Web Service. System Architecture and prototyping execution model of the system is described in BPEL4WS.

  • PDF

다중 에이전트 기반 워크플로우 모델링 시스템에 관한 연구 (A Study on Multi Agent-Based Workflow Modeling System)

  • 김학성;김광훈;백수기
    • 인터넷정보학회논문지
    • /
    • 제3권4호
    • /
    • pp.19-26
    • /
    • 2002
  • 본 논문에서는 워크플로우 관리 시스템의 빌드타임 기능에 속하는 모델링 시스템을 다중 에이전트 기반으로 구현하였다. 본 논문에서 제안된 다중 에이전트 기반 워크플로우 모델링 시스템은 클라이언트의 경량을 위하여 자바를 이용하였으며, 프로세스 정의에 필요한 세션, 조직, 관련데이터, 응용프로그램 속성들을 별도의 에이전트로 구성하였다 또한, 프로세스 정의를 위한 모델은 ICN(Information Control Net)을 이용하여 작성된 모델의 문법(syntax)를 검증하였으며, 타 워크플로우 엔진과의 연동을 위하여 WfMC에서 정의된 인터페이스 형태인 WPDL로 import/export할 수 있는 기능을 제공한다.

  • PDF

워크플로우 기반의 제품라인 소프트웨어 개발 지원 환경 (A Tool for Workflow-based Product Line Software Development)

  • 양진석;강교철
    • 정보처리학회논문지:소프트웨어 및 데이터공학
    • /
    • 제2권6호
    • /
    • pp.377-382
    • /
    • 2013
  • 제품라인공학 기반의 융합소프트웨어 개발 방법론에서는 어플리케이션 개발을 위해 아키텍처 모델을 제안하고 있다. 그리고 명세를 이용하여 제어컴포넌트를 개발하도록 제안하는데 워크플로우는 트랜잭션을 주로 처리하는 어플리케이션 개발을 위해 제안되었다. 제품라인 공학 기반의 소프트웨어 개발이 효과를 발휘하기 위해서는 도구의 지원이 반드시 필요하다. 하지만 기존의 워크플로우 모델링 도구들은 제품라인 공학개념을 지원하지 않기 때문에 워크플로우 기반의 제품라인 소프트웨어 개발을 지원할 수 있는 도구의 개발이 필요했다. 본 논문에서는 워크플로우 기반의 제품라인 소프트웨어 개발을 지원하기 위해서 개발된 도구를 소개하고 개발된 도구의 활용 가능성을 확인하기 위해서 간단한 활용예제를 소개한다.

제품 개발 프로세스 관리를 위한 다층 통합 워크플로우 시스템 개발 (Development of a Multi-Layered Workflow Management System for Product Development Processes)

  • 강석호;김영호;김동수;배준수;배혜림
    • 경영과학
    • /
    • 제16권1호
    • /
    • pp.187-201
    • /
    • 1999
  • In this paper, we propose a multi-layered architecture of workflow management systems based on CORBA (Common Object Request Broker Architecture). The system aims to support product development processes in distributed environment. Many companies have started to adopt workflow management systems to manage and support their business processes. However, there are many problems in direct application of those systems to product development environments. These mainly resulted from the dynamic features of product development processes. It is strongly required to support dynamic processes as well as static and procedural ones in an integrated and consistent manner. To meet these requirements, a basic workflow management system has been developed as the core component of the integrated architecture. This performs the basic functions of workflow management system. Second, a dynamic workflow management system based on a bidding mechanism has been developed to manage processes that cannot be easily defined or are likely to be modified, Finally, an SGML workflow management system, which is the third layer in the architecture, has been developed to manage documents processing workflows by integration SGML documents contents and process information into the structured SGML document.

  • PDF

CPC에서의 Workflow 응용 (Applying Workflow Management System to CPC)

  • 전희철
    • 한국CDE학회지
    • /
    • 제8권1호
    • /
    • pp.58-65
    • /
    • 2002
  • Collaborative product commerce(CPC) involves many people working together with heterogeneous and distributed software applications. For such an environment, Workflow Management System(WFMS) can be useful for coordination of people, software agents and processes. It provides diverse services including automatic work muting, project management continuous process improvement and application integration. However, there are some limitations to apply WFMS to CPC environment due to inflexibility and lack of design support facilities. This paper identifies the problems and addresses possible approaches to overcome the difficulties.

  • PDF

분산 트랜잭션 워크플로우 모니터링 시스템의 설계 및 구현 (Design and Implementation of a Distributed Transactional Workflow Monitoring System)

  • 민준기;김광훈;정중수
    • 정보처리학회논문지D
    • /
    • 제13D권1호
    • /
    • pp.139-146
    • /
    • 2006
  • 본 논문에서는 분산 트랜잭션 워크플로우 모니터링 시스템의 설계 및 구현에 관하여 기술한다. 워크플로우 인스턴스들의 실행 상태 관리를 주요 목적으로 하는 전통적인 워크플로우 시스템의 모니터링 기능은 워크플로우의 초대형화와 트랜잭션화를 특징으로 하는 분산형 트랜잭션 워크플로우 시스템에서는 워크플로우의 처리 상태 관리뿐만 아니라 구조적인 정보의 수집, 통계 정보 제공, 사용자들의 처리 상태 정보 등과 같은 다양한 부가적인 정보 처리 및 관리 기능을 제공하는 분산형 모니터링 서비스를 필요로 한다. 본 논문에서는 이러한 분산형 트랜잭션 워크플로우 시스템에서 필수적으로 요구되는 새로운 워크플로우 모니터링의 특징을 확장 정의하고, 이를 지원하는 점 기반의 분산 트랜잭션 워크플로우 모니터링 시스템의 상세 설계 및 이의 구현 방안을 소개한다.

워크플로우 및 워크플로우 관리 시스템의 새로운 조망 (A Fresh Look on Workflow and Workflow Management System)

  • 한동수;심재용
    • 한국정보과학회논문지:데이타베이스
    • /
    • 제28권3호
    • /
    • pp.395-405
    • /
    • 2001
  • 본 논문에서는 워크플로우와 워크플로우 관리 시스템을 프로그래밍 언어 관점에서 분석하였다. 워크플로우 관련 데이터, 워크플로우 제어 구조 그리고 응용 프로그램 기동 등 많은 워크플로우 특성이 분산 병렬 프로그램의 해당 항목과 비교되었다. 그 결과 비록 사소한 차이는 존재하였지만 놀랍게도 그들간에는 많은 유사성이 존재함을 확인할 수 있었다. 이러한 관찰에 근거하여 본 논문에서는 워크플로우 관리 시스템을 분산 병렬 프로그램 개발 플랫폼으로 조망하는 것을 제안하였다. 워크플로우 관리 시스템에 관한 이러한 새로운 조망을 통하여 워크플로우 시스템 사용자는 보다 일관성 있는 관점에서 워크플로우를 바라볼 수 있으며 워크플로우 관리 시스템 설계자는 워크플로우 시스템 설계의 일관성을 유지하면서 워크플로우 시스템에 대한 다양한 요구에 대응할 수 있게 된다. 또한 본 논문에서 제시한 워크플로우와 프로그램의 유사성은 워크플로우와 관련된 많은 분석 기법의 개발에 이미 개발된 프로그램 분석기법을 원용 할 수 있는 논리적 기반을 제공한다.

  • PDF